To deny that fairies exist, do I need to have a degree in fairy-ology? I freely admit I don't have the science bona fides, but as a scientist, you are quite aware that the burden of proof lies with those making claims. If I claim there is a china teapot orbiting Jupiter this very moment, there is no reason to believe that that is true unless I provide some evidence. If I fail to provide adequate evidence, then there is no reason to believe the teapot is there.

I take it you are also familiar with Occam's Razor. The simplest explanation for how everything in the universe works is that there are no supernatural agencies of any sort, and that life is a series of electro-chemical reactions. Yes, it might be "simpler" to say that a god made something, but I would argue that that isn't an explanation, but more of a lazy excuse.

For anything supernatural to exist (including ghosts, psychic phenomena, etc.) the known laws of nature have to be suspended, or simply be wrong. Let's go back to fairies, shall we? There are some people who believe in them. If fairies exist, we might ask, how come no one has ever taken a photo of one? Because they're invisible, a believer might answer, but that would mean that all the laws of nature that say that material things are visible (sometimes only with help, in the case of atoms or other particles), and all the empirical evidence which has supported those laws, and indeed has made them laws.
